Merging Lands, Bridging Lives: Kokufu E-bike Tour, Immersive Satoyama Scenery and Lifestyle Experience

Merging Lands, Bridging Lives: Kokufu E-bike Tour, Immersive Satoyama Scenery and Lifestyle Experience

North Gifu

Nature & Activities

Grab an e-bike and ride into a refreshing and exhilarating exploration of Japan's satoyama (areas where foothills and farmlands overlap) and the roots of its thriving. Swing by wellsprings before enjoying a delectable lunch of Hoba-zushi, a local Hida cuisine, at Sakurano Park. The blossoms of the approximately 300 cherry trees are especially magnificent in spring. Next is Ankoku-ji Temple (northern Gifu’s only national treasure, a storehouse preserving ancient Buddhist scriptures), having tea at a traditional Japanese house, then taking in the vistas along the Araki River while cycling. The rare opportunity of spending time to chat with and connect with the locals, whether in the cozy atmosphere of a traditional Japanese home or during your cycling adventure, will surely be a memorable part of your journey. A part of the fee from this course will be donated to the communities overseeing the conservation of the local culture heritage.

Summer Steps Onwards: Sawaaruki (River Trekking) Tour with Specialty OFF THE GRID COFFEE

Summer Steps Onwards: Sawaaruki (River Trekking) Tour with Specialty OFF THE GRID COFFEE

North Gifu

Nature & Activities

Immerse yourself in the grand outdoors of Hida Takayama through this gentle, leisurely summer hike through sparkling clear waters, flowing over massive rocks formed from volcanic activity thousands of years ago. Savor and learn all you can about nature's wonders, stopping for a break to enjoy hand-dripped gourmet coffee and tasty baked goodies personally prepared for you by a professional barista. Look forward to a wholesome lunch of sandwich and soup made from ingredients locally sourced. You will be accompanied by a main guide - an experienced nature guide and member of the Japan Mountain Guides Association with Wilderness Advanced First Aid (WAFA) and Leave No Trace (LNT) qualifications, a supporting guide, and a barista, as you journey through the Soredani mountain stream, tucked away in the area between Nyukawa Town and Kamitakara Town in Takayama City. Guides are fluent in English so you can freely chat and banter about along the way. Equipment rental is also available.

Life Springs Eternal: Hakusan Culture Half-day Tour

Life Springs Eternal: Hakusan Culture Half-day Tour

Central Gifu

Life & Culture

Enter the sanctuary of the Hakusan Shinko (Hakusan Faith), originating from Mount Hakusan, one of Japan's Three Holy Mountains. Discover its history at the Hakusan Culture Museum, before moving on to the Nagataki Hakusan-jinja Shrine, the most important of all Hakusan shrines in Japan. A guide will show you the ins and outs of correct etiquette when visiting a shrine, and walk you through powerspots and local sites of Important Cultural Properties of Japan. You will also receive blessings from the chief Shinto priest during your visit. Goshuin (red seal) featured in a Taiga (historical) drama included.

Miraculous Edge: Cemented Carbide Original KISEKI: Pocketknife-making and Factory Tour

Miraculous Edge: Cemented Carbide Original KISEKI: Pocketknife-making and Factory Tour

Central Gifu

Tradition & History

Take on this very special hands-on tour of the factory behind the wildly popular (to the point it's especially hard to buy before it's sold out), high-grade, cemented carbide kitchen knives - a first in Japan! Watch the production process, help with sharpening and testing blades. After the tour, create your very own original pocket knife by affixing the cemented carbide (said to be the hardest material next to diamond) blade to the handle, made in Gifu Prefecture. You can also buy knives and sharpening stones. Lunch will be miso sukiyaki made with delicious Hida beef and salad, sliced and diced with KISEKI: knives at Hana, a restaurant in a traditional Japanese house.

Friendly Deception: Traditional tomozuri fishing and prized salt-grilled sweetfish

Friendly Deception: Traditional tomozuri fishing and prized salt-grilled sweetfish

Central Gifu

Tradition & History

Food & Drink

Fish for Gifu's renowned ayu (sweetfish) using a method tried and tested by time! Presenting the tomozuri (live decoy fishing) style, which you will be introduced to through training videos in a lesson before putting it to practice while standing in the Nagara River with support from a professional guide. Then, dig in to the freshly caught sweetfish, salted and grilled. Enjoy its mouth-watering taste and compare it to that of the locally farmed ayu. Ayu rice will also be served. Discover the goodness of "Ayu of the Nagara River System," a Globally Important Agricultural Heritage System (GIAHS).

Life Springs Eternal: Hakusan Culture Pilgrimage 1-day Tour​

Life Springs Eternal: Hakusan Culture Pilgrimage 1-day Tour​

Central Gifu

Life & Culture

Enter the sanctuary of the Hakusan Shinko (Hakusan Faith), and encounter the spiritual culture of Japan from ancient times as you make your pilgrimage in honorable shiroshozoku (white robes). Discover the rich history between faith and nature at the Hakusan Culture Museum, then move to the Nagataki Hakusan-jinja Shrine, where a guide will show you the ins and outs of correct etiquette when visiting a shrine and praying. Be astounded by an afternoon visit to the dynamic Amidaga Falls, one of Japan‘s top 100 waterfalls and a subject of a majestic ukiyo-e piece done by Katsushika Hokusai, a leading artist in Japan's Edo period. Next, draw close to the spiritual grounds of the Hakusan Faith at the Hakusan Chukyo-jinja Shrine, the main place of worship for Hakusan followers, before treading stone steps that will lead you to the Itoshiro Osugi - a great, sacred cedar tree of 1800 years said to mark the beginning of the trail made by Taicho Daishi, the founder of Mount Hakusan. Enjoy a refreshingly delightful lunch of delicious nagashi somen near Amidaga Falls.
